More than just an ocean safari
African Ocean Safaris offers guided marine eco-tours in Table Bay, showcasing the rich marine biodiversity against the backdrop of Table Mountain. Led by expert marine biologists, guests encounter dolphins, seals, penguins and more, all whilst learning about the ocean's role in climate regulation and conservation. Our tours aim to inspire a lasting connection to marine life and foster environmental awareness.
